Decoding Excellence in Tirana's Culinary Scene
As you start your search for "restaurants near me" in Tirana, it is vital to look beyond just the menu. The best restaurants in tirana are defined by a combination of qualities that create a complete sensory experience. Atmosphere plays a significant role, whether you prefer a vibrant urban setting or a serene, intimate space. Superb service, where staff are knowledgeable and passionate, can elevate a good meal into a great one. Naturally, the standard and genuineness of the cuisine are the top priority. Search for establishments that emphasize fresh, local ingredients. Below are several crucial points to keep in mind:
- Genuine Flavors: A menu that celebrates traditional Albanian recipes and perhaps offering a modern twist.
- Charming Atmosphere: A setting that is comfortable and complements the dining experience.
- Top-Notch Staff: Attentive staff who are eager to share recommendations and stories.
- Fresh, Local Ingredients: A dedication to using seasonal local produce, meats, and cheeses.
- Positive Reviews & Reputation: Great feedback from both locals and tourists.
These elements combined are what truly make the city's top restaurants stand out from the rest.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: What kind of food are the best restaurants in tirana known for?
A: Tirana is famous for a diverse culinary heritage. Expect to see dishes like Tavë Kosi (baked lamb and yogurt), Fërgesë (a rich stew of peppers, tomatoes, and cheese), and Byrek (savory pie). Many of the best restaurants also excel at fresh Mediterranean and Italian-influenced cuisine. - Q: Should I make reservations when searching for restaurants near me?
A: For the more popular and best restaurants in tirana, especially on Friday and Saturday nights or for larger groups, reservations are highly recommended. For more casual restaurants or for lunch, you can usually find a table without booking in advance. - Q: How can I find authentic, local restaurants away from the main tourist areas?
A: A great method is to walk through residential neighborhoods like Blloku or the areas around the New Bazaar (Pazari i Ri). Don't be afraid to ask locals for their personal favorites. Often, the most authentic dining experiences are found in modest places that are bustling with local patrons.
